Transaction ec8aa9027049d20b2a91e0e29e52a5bb115d9ec784681e0aa99f83d1a216d6b0
1 Input
1 Output
-
ec8aa9027049d20b2a91e0e29e52a5bb115d9ec784681e0aa99f83d1a216d6b0:0
- value
- 29369
- script pubkey
- OP_0 OP_PUSHBYTES_20 543cd839cac32e8820cf24fb5ad4d3f4130f7123
- address
- bc1q2s7dsww2cvhgsgx0yna444xn7sfs7ufrk37vta